Session's church fires back

In response to Session's quoting the Bible as if to justify child concentration camps, the church he identifies with, the United Methodist, fired back:

"Jesus is our way, our truth, our life. The Christ we follow would have no part in ripping children from their mothers' arms or shunning those fleeing violence. It is unimaginable that faith leaders even have to say that these policies are antithetical to the teachings of Christ. Christian sacred texts should never be used to justify policies that oppress or harm children and families."

The Church also noted that the Bible passage Session quoted (Romans 13) also requires Christians to "extend hospitality to strangers" and to do "no wrong to a neighbor." So much for fake Christians like Sessions.
